Damn! Originally, Nightshade Vale had only intended to exchange a few blows with Kaito—just enough to chip away at his arrogance. Never in his wildest expectations did he think he'd be forced into a relentless retreat instead. His pride as an expert refused to admit defeat in a normal exchange, but the truth was undeniable.

The Flaming Solstice Blade was already arcing toward him again, the silver flames licking its edge like a predator ready to pounce. Gritting his teeth, Nightshade Vale used Block, his daggers crossing in a desperate defense. One more direct hit from that blazing sword, and he knew he'd be finished.

Not good. Time to leave. The gap between our stats is just too wide.

After clashing head-on with Kaito, he understood the disparity between them all too clearly—especially that eerie silver flame. Every time his equipment met it, the durability dropped alarmingly. His silver-ranked dagger could endure for now, losing only a small amount with each impact, but the Mysterious Iron–rank armor he had worked so hard to obtain was already suffering. A single stab from Kaito had stripped away over a quarter of its total durability. If this continued, his entire set would crumble, leaving him exposed and helpless.

Without the attributes his gear provided, he wouldn't last more than a few seconds against Kaito's assault. Without hesitation, he turned and bolted.

"You can't escape."

Kaito's voice was calm, but his steps were a blur. Activating Wind veil Steps and mana steps again, he moved like a phantom, closing the gap in the blink of an eye. His blade danced, releasing a storm of sixteen sword images that closed in from every direction. The flames trailing from each stroke surged together, forming a wall of searing heat meant to swallow Nightshade Vale whole.

Nightshade Vale's eyes widened. There was no way to block so many strikes at once. In a flash, he activated Wind Steps, the brief one-second invincibility nullifying the assault before boosting his speed to its peak. Without missing a beat, he slipped into stealth.

"I said—you cannot get away."

Kaito vaulted forward, the Dragon Fang in his off-hand roaring to life as fire and lightning merged along its edge. The explosive energy of Blazing Thunder Clash ripped toward the assassin's escape path.

Nightshade Vale's instincts screamed at him. He had seen this move before, back when Kaito fought Gravemind's team—it was devastating. He immediately triggered Vanish, using its one-second invincibility to evade both the impact and the stunning effect.

But now… his arsenal was empty. All his lifesaving skills were gone.

Just like last time, he leapt toward the treeline, aiming to lose Kaito among the branches. But the moment his feet left the ground—

Boom!

A Cryo Core Orb detonated at the exact spot where he had used Vanish. The icy explosion locked his legs in place mid-motion, frost crackling up his boots. His stealth shattered instantly, leaving him exposed. Though the orb didn't deal damage, its control effect was more than enough.

Kaito's eyes glinted with satisfaction. "Got you."

Once again, sixteen blazing sword images erupted from the Solstice Blade, driving straight for Nightshade Vale's unguarded form.

This time, Nightshade Vale had no choice but to pour every ounce of skill into defense, his daggers a blur as he intercepted the flurry of strikes.

Two sword images—blocked.

Four—parried with gritted teeth.

Six—his arms trembled under the relentless force.

By the time he deflected the eleventh, his defense finally cracked. The remaining sword images crashed through his guard like a tidal wave.

One after another, red damage numbers erupted above his head. –312! –348! –402! –397! Each strike bit deep, and the silver flames seared through his armor like acid. At the same time, the durability of his gear plummeted at an alarming rate.

By the time his HP hit zero, the armor he had painstakingly gathered over countless hours was nothing more than shattered scraps. The loss struck him like a physical blow. He clenched his jaw so hard it hurt, fury and heartbreak twisting his expression. All that effort… gone in moments.

The only solace—if it could even be called that—was that his two silver-ranked daggers, as precious to him as his own life, had somehow survived the destruction.

Then, his body hit the forest floor with a dull thud, an expression of unwillingness still etched on his face. Moments later, it dissolved into motes of light, carried away by the wind.

"I told you—you're not getting away," Kaito said coldly. His gaze shifted to the silver-colored dagger lying among the loot, its gleaming edge glinting like moonlight. "I'll gratefully accept this."

He bent down, picking it up and turning it in his hand. The blade was so sharp it seemed to slice the air with every subtle movement. A weapon of this caliber was exceedingly rare.

Just by holding it, he could feel the faint vibration of condensed killing intent radiating from the blade.

He quickly pulled up the item panel.

[Assassin's Dagger] (Dagger, Silver Rank)

Level Requirement: 12

Attack Power: +81

Strength: +10

Agility: +15

Attack Speed: +8%

Durability: 35/60

Additional Passive Skill – Sharp Edge:

Attacks have a 15% chance to cause an Armor Break effect, reducing the target's Defense by 50% for 10 seconds. (Non-stackable)

Class Restriction: Assassin

With such high attack power and agility, it was no wonder Nightshade Vale had been able to inflict such devastating damage earlier. The Assassin's Dagger was clearly crafted for one purpose—to maximize an assassin's killing potential through sheer speed and precision. For agility-focused assassins, it was a dream weapon.

By Kaito's estimation, this dagger alone was worth at least one gold coin. With its loss, Nightshade Vale would face a long and painful road to recovery.

Kaito studied the weapon with a faint smile tugging at his lips. Not long ago, he had been wary of the man who stalked him from the shadows, waiting for the perfect moment to strike. But now, thanks to the Whisper Flame, he had turned the tables—thoroughly beating Nightshade Vale and stripping him of everything in the process.

Not only had Nightshade Vale lost a level, but every piece of equipment he wore had been destroyed. To make matters worse for the assassin, he had dropped his prized dagger upon death. It would be a long time before Nightshade Vale could muster the strength to come after him again.

The forest around him remained silent, the only sound the faint rustle of leaves in the wind. Satisfied, Kaito sheathed his weapon and resumed his journey, heading straight for the Black Market's teleportation area.

Kaito crossed the shallow ravine and entered a familiar clearing, where silent stone spires stood like ancient sentinels. Their faint runes pulsed as he approached.

Without hesitation, he raised his hand and spoke the same phrase as before.

"Vereska Tal."

The runes flared crimson. A heartbeat later, the air rippled and folded inward, revealing a circular platform of black marble that rose smoothly from the earth. At its center, a single floating sigil turned slowly, radiating a faint, cold light.

[Hidden Formation Detected – Black Market Gateway (Old World Anchor)]

[Access Granted – Known Password]

[Teleportation Initiating…]

Stepping onto the formation, Kaito felt the familiar pull as the forest dissolved around him. In the next instant, the underground expanse of the Black Market unfolded before his eyes.

While, Kaito was in the midst of finalizing his transaction with Selvera

South Glade Town – Lower District

Nightshade Vale sat slouched in his chair inside the bar, a half-empty bottle in hand. He drank in silence, the faint clink of glass against wood punctuating the oppressive atmosphere around him.

Those who noticed his presence gave him a wide berth, instinctively retreating to the far edges of the room. It wasn't just his reputation—it was the palpable killing intent rolling off him in heavy waves, like a predator barely leashing its fury. No one in their right mind wanted to test whether that simmering wrath might turn on them.
